Understanding Hydraulic Cylinder Repair
What is Hydraulic Cylinder Repair?
Hydraulic cylinder repair is a critical maintenance process designed to restore the functionality of hydraulic cylinders used in various machinery and equipment. These components are essential for converting hydraulic energy into linear motion, which is pivotal in many industrial applications. When a hydraulic cylinder malfunctions, it can lead to inefficiency, safety risks, and breakdowns. The repair process involves diagnosing issues, replacing defective parts, and ensuring the cylinder operates smoothly and reliably. A comprehensive approach to hydraulic cylinder repair can save time and expenses compared to full replacement, making it an attractive option for many operators.
Signs Your Cylinder Needs Repair
Identifying problems early can significantly reduce downtime and repair costs. Here are some common signs that your hydraulic cylinder may need repair:
- Leakage: Visible fluid leaks around seals or fittings are often the first indication of a problem.
- Sluggish Movement: If the cylinder does not extend or retract smoothly or responds slowly, it may indicate internal damage.
- Increased Noise: Unusual sounds such as grinding or clanking during operation can signify mechanical failure.
- Misalignment: If the attached load shows signs of misalignment or crooked movement, the cylinder may not be functioning correctly.
- Excessive Wear: Visible wear and tear on the cylinder’s exterior or damage to the rod can compromise performance.
Common Issues Leading to Repairs
Several factors can contribute to the need for hydraulic cylinder repairs:
- Seal Failure: Seals can wear out over time due to friction, heat, or contamination, leading to leaks.
- Corrosion: Exposure to harsh environments can cause corrosion on the cylinder’s exterior and internal components.
- Pressure Surges: Unexpected spikes in hydraulic pressure can damage seals and internal parts.
- Improper Maintenance: Lack of regular inspections and maintenance can hasten the deterioration of the cylinder’s components.
- Contaminated Fluid: Dirty or degraded hydraulic fluid can lead to pump failures and other issues.
Preparing for Hydraulic Cylinder Repair
Necessary Tools and Equipment
Before beginning hydraulic cylinder repair, it’s essential to gather the right tools and equipment. Common tools include:
- Wrench Set: Essential for loosening and tightening bolts securely.
- Seal Pullers: Useful for removing old seals without damaging cylinder components.
- Calipers: For measuring internal diameters to ensure proper sealing.
- Torque Wrench: Ensures bolts are tightened to the manufacturer’s specifications.
- Hydraulic Oil: The appropriate hydraulic oil is crucial for maintaining cylinder integrity during reassembly.
- Work Benches: Area to lay out tools and components to streamline the repair process.
Safety Precautions to Take
Safety is paramount when dealing with hydraulic systems. Here are some critical safety precautions:
- Wear Protective Gear: Use gloves, goggles, and protective clothing to shield yourself from potential hazards.
- Release Pressure: Always release hydraulic pressure before disassembly to avoid injury.
- Work in a Ventilated Area: Ensure adequate ventilation to prevent inhalation of harmful fumes from hydraulic oil.
- Keep Workspace Clean: A tidy workspace reduces the risk of accidents and misplaced tools.
- Follow Manufacturer Guidelines: Always adhere to manufacturer instructions for repairs and safety protocols.
Disassembling the Hydraulic Cylinder
Disassembling a hydraulic cylinder requires careful attention to detail to avoid damage. Follow these steps:
- Prepare the Workspace: Clear the area of unnecessary items, ensuring you have enough space to work.
- Document the Assembly: Take pictures or notes of the assembly as you take it apart, which will aid reassembly.
- Remove the Cylinder from Machinery: Disconnect hydraulic lines and carefully remove the cylinder from its housing.
- Loosen Fasteners: Use the correct tools to remove all fasteners while ensuring not to damage the components.
- Extract Internal Components: Carefully pull out the piston and other elements while inspecting for wear or damage.
Step-by-Step Hydraulic Cylinder Repair Process
Inspecting Damaged Components
Once the hydraulic cylinder is dismantled, thoroughly inspect all components:
- Check Seals: Look for tears, hardening, or other damage that could impact performance.
- Evaluate the Rod: Inspect for scratches, corrosion, or scoring that may require treatment or replacement.
- Look for Pitting: Examine the interior of the cylinder bore for signs of pitting or significant wear.
- Assess the End Caps: Ensure that the end caps are intact and not warped or damaged.
Replacing Seals and O-rings
Replacing seals and O-rings is often one of the primary steps in hydraulic cylinder repair. Here’s how to do it effectively:
- Remove Old Seals: Use seal pullers or a similar tool to extract the old seals carefully.
- Clean the Grooves: Thoroughly clean seal grooves and inspect them for debris or damage.
- Apply Lubrication: Lightly lubricate the new O-rings and seals to create a better fit during installation.
- Install Seals: Carefully position the new seals in their respective grooves, ensuring they fit snugly.
Reassembling the Hydraulic Cylinder
Proper reassembly of the hydraulic cylinder is crucial for its functionality. Follow these steps:
- Install the Piston: Carefully insert the piston back into the cylinder, ensuring seals are properly placed.
- Reconnect Components: Reattach end caps and any other components in the order you documented during disassembly.
- Tighten Fasteners: Use a torque wrench to ensure all fasteners are tightened to the manufacturer’s specifications.
- Check Alignment: Ensure that all components are properly aligned before finalizing assembly.
- Refill with Hydraulic Fluid: Refill the cylinder with the necessary hydraulic fluid, following the correct guidelines.
Preventive Maintenance for Hydraulic Cylinders
Regular Inspection Practices
To prolong the life of hydraulic cylinders and avoid costly repairs, establish a routine inspection schedule. Effective practices include:
- Visual Inspections: Regularly check for leaks, wear, or other visible signs of damage.
- Fluid Levels: Monitor hydraulic fluid levels and top up as necessary to maintain optimal operation.
- Pressure Checks: Regularly check for unexpected fluctuations in pressure which can indicate underlying problems.
- System Cleanliness: Ensure that the hydraulic system is clean and free of contaminants.
Lubrication and Care Tips
Proper lubrication and care can greatly enhance the performance and lifespan of hydraulic cylinders. Consider the following tips:
- Regular Lubrication: Use the recommended hydraulic oil and maintain proper lubrication schedules.
- Seal Maintenance: Regularly inspect and replace seals as needed to avoid leaks.
- Environmental Protection: Consider using protective coverings when the equipment is not in use.
- Training: Offer training for operators to recognize early warning signs and promote better care.
Common Mistakes to Avoid
To ensure successful hydraulic cylinder repair and maintenance, avoid these common mistakes:
- Neglecting Maintenance: Overlooking routine inspections can lead to unforeseen failures.
- Using Incorrect Parts: Always use manufacturer-recommended parts for repairs to ensure compatibility.
- Ignoring Fluid Quality: Poor-quality hydraulic fluid can lead to multiple system issues.
- Failing to Document Repairs: Keep a log of repairs performed to track maintenance history and plan future checks.
Frequently Asked Questions About Hydraulic Cylinder Repair
Is it worth repairing a hydraulic cylinder?
Yes, repairing a hydraulic cylinder is often more cost-effective than replacing it. A thorough repair can restore efficiency and prolong its lifespan, while reducing downtime and costs.
How long does a hydraulic cylinder repair take?
The time required for repair varies, but it typically ranges from a few hours to a day, depending on the extent of damage and the complexity of the cylinder.
What are the costs involved in hydraulic cylinder repair?
Costs for hydraulic cylinder repair can vary widely based on the type of cylinder, parts needed, and labor rates, typically ranging from $150 to $1,500 or more, depending on repairs.
Can I repair my hydraulic cylinder myself?
Yes, provided you have the right tools and knowledge. It’s essential to follow manufacturer guidelines and take all safety precautions when performing repairs.
How do I know if my cylinder needs a rebuild?
If multiple components are worn, or if the cylinder has repeated issues after repairs, it may be more cost-effective to consider a rebuild instead of repeated repairs.
